Message type: E = Error
Message class: 0D - FS-CD General Messages
Message number: 420
Message text: No authorization to display data transfer document data

- No authorization to display data transfer document data ?The SAP error message 0D420 ("No authorization to display data transfer document data") typically occurs when a user attempts to access data related to a data transfer document (DTD) but lacks the necessary authorizations. This can happen in various SAP modules, particularly in logistics and inventory management.
Cause:
The error is primarily caused by insufficient authorization in the user's role or profile. The specific authorization object that is usually involved is
S_DOKU_AUTH
, which controls access to document-related data. If the user does not have the required permissions to view the data transfer document, this error will be triggered.Solution:
To resolve this issue, you can follow these steps:
Check User Authorizations:
- Use transaction code SU53 immediately after encountering the error. This will show you the last authorization check that failed and provide insights into which specific authorization object is missing.
Review User Roles:
- Go to transaction code PFCG to review the roles assigned to the user. Check if the roles include the necessary authorizations for accessing data transfer documents.
Modify Roles:
- If the required authorizations are missing, you may need to modify the existing roles or create a new role that includes the necessary authorizations. Ensure that the role includes the appropriate values for the authorization object
S_DOKU_AUTH
.Consult with Security Team:
- If you do not have the necessary permissions to change roles or authorizations, contact your SAP security team or administrator. They can help you adjust the roles or provide the necessary access.
Testing:
- After making changes to the roles or authorizations, have the user log out and log back in to test if the issue is resolved.
